I have a 100 ft. deep 2 inch packer well with a 1 inch drop pipe. casing and drop pipe are
galvinized. the well was dug in 1962, has not been used for about 40 yrs. I attempted to
pull the drop pipe, will not budge or turn. pored 1 gallon of chlorex between drop pipe and 2 inch
casing, still stuck. Any suggestions would be greatly appreciated.
